Global Fetal Monitoring Market Definition
A diagnostic tool used to monitor the movement and heart rate of the foetus and maternal contractions is known as a Fetal Monitoring system. It is a fundamental device that is used for monitoring uterine contractions during labor. It mainly monitors well-being of the foetus and progress of labor. In medical terms, it is referred to as a medical method to check the health of an unborn baby to ensure a safe birth. It is also used to keep track of jaundice, mental retardation, newborn illnesses, hypothermia, visual and hearing issues, and chronic lung ailments. During labor and in pregnancy, the doctor checks the heartbeat of the baby to monitor the health of the unborn foetus. It is a very common procedure adopted by healthcare providers during labor and pregnancy.
There are two ways to do the monitoring. First is the external monitoring that requires a special tool called fetoscope that uses sound waves and computers. The second way of monitoring is internal monitoring that requires putting a small electrode on the baby's head while he or she is in a female uterus. The information obtained from these systems gives the healthcare provider the idea to intervene in the birth process or not.

The Global Fetal Monitoring Market is segmented on the basis of Raw Material, Method, End User, Application, And Geography.
Based on Raw Material, the market is segmented into Instruments & Consumables, Ultrasound & Ultrasonography, Electronic Fetal Monitoring, Fetal Electrodes, Fetal Doppler, Uterine Contraction Monitor, Telemetry Solutions, Accessories & Consumables, Software, and Other Products. Ultrasound devices are the largest segment in this market. This segment's growth can primarily be attributed to technological advancements, increasing congenital anomalies, maternal mortality, and rising regulatory approvals.
Based on Method, the market is segmented into Invasive, Non-invasive. The noninvasive held the majority of the market share. Particularly in high-risk pregnancies, noninvasive technologies are widely regarded for their safer manner of identifying and monitoring the baby. The expansion of this market is driven by the increasing approvals of different noninvasive monitoring devices and emerging sophisticated technologies.
Based on End-user, The Market is Segmented into Hospitals, Clinics, and Others. Hospitals accounted for the largest share of this market. This segment's growth can be attributed to several factors, such as highly advanced facilities in hospitals and the increasing number of pregnancy procedures. Technological advancements, coupled with government funding, are also encouraging the installation of new tools and devices in hospitals, thus supporting market growth.
Based on Application, The market is divided into Intrapartum Foetal Monitoring and Antepartum Foetal Monitoring. The market for Fetal Monitoring is dominated by the antepartum sector. For the purpose of diagnosing any congenital fetal anomalies, antepartum Fetal Monitoring is done during the whole gestation period. The antepartum category is expanding as a result of intensive monitoring protocols, recent product introductions, an increasing occurrence of fetal abnormalities, and maternal fatalities.
